Software Engineer - Data and Monitoring Education, Training & Library - Malibu, CA at Geebo

Software Engineer - Data and Monitoring

Malibu, CAScience & Engineering - Materials & Microsystems Laboratory Materials & Microsystems /Regular /On-siteBased in Southern California with locations in Malibu, Calabasas, Westlake Village and Camarillo; HRL has been on the leading edge of technology, conducting pioneering research and advancing the state of the art.
General Description:
As a senior software engineer in the Internal Tools group you will be responsible for building tools to collect logs and metrics from various hardware and software components of our quantum infrastructure; examples include making key data searchable, building endpoint monitoring into existing APIs, and maintaining the monitoring software stack across multiple enterprise networks.
You will operate as part of a cross-functional team (IT, Physicists, Software Engineers, Data Scientists, and Industrial Technicians) and will often be the main link between otherwise disparate groups.
This role is high-impact with high visibility, and the services you build and maintain will be an essential part of the function of the Quantum Software team.
Supervisory
Responsibilities:
Expected to display technical leadershipMay be required to mentor junior staff and oversee their contributions to specific projectsEssential Duties:
Build and maintain infrastructure for scraping logs, capturing metrics, enriching/processing data, and sending it to ElasticsearchBuild endpoint monitoring into APIsProfile and tune Elasticsearch deployment to maintain performanceDevelop internal tools written in Python as well as various shell-scripting languages (batch, powershell, and bash)Develop procedures and standards for archival and backup of data storesWork with developers and end-users to build queries, dashboards, and reports to support business objectivesWork with data scientists and engineers to develop and implement anomaly detection routines and machine-learning algorithmsMaintain a high level of industry knowledge and best practices; stay abreast of new tooling options; provide recommendations for enhancing, upgrading, deprecating monitoring stack as appropriateRequired Skills:
Demonstrated expertise with Elasticsearch ELK stackFamiliarity with medium- to high-volume logging, syslog, and its associated servicesExperience writing SQL queriesExperience writing shell scriptsSolid understanding of core computer science fundamentals including data structures, algorithms, and computer architecturesBasic familiarity with statistics and data scienceStrong communication skills; ability to write and maintain comprehensive, readable documentationRequired Education:
7
years relevant software engineering experience.
Physical Requirements:
Strong verbal communication skillsProgram a computer via keyboard or some other method that is as fast as a typical programmer on a keyboardProgram a computer with visual feedback from a computer monitorLong hours sitting or standing to program a computerSpecial Requirements:
U.
S.
citizenship; active security clearance or ability to obtain one.
Personable and pleasant to have on a teamCompensation:
The base salary range for this full-time position is $145,745 - $186,688
bonus
benefits.
Our salary ranges are determined by role, level, and location.
The range displayed on each job posting reflects the minimum and maximum target for new hire salaries for the position.
Within the range, individual pay is determined by work location and additional factors, including job-related skills, experience, and relevant education or training.
Your recruiter can share more about the specific salary range during the hiring process.
Please note that the compensation details listed reflect the base salary only, and do not include potential bonus or benefits.
Don't meet every single requirement? Studies have shown that some people are less likely to apply to jobs unless they meet every single desired qualification.
At HRL, we are dedicated to building a diverse, inclusive, and authentic workplace, so if you're excited about this role but your past experience doesn't align perfectly with every qualification in the job description, we encourage you to apply anyway.
You may be just the right candidate for this or other roles.
HRL offers a very competitive compensation and benefits package.
Our Regular/Full Time benefits include medical, dental, vision, life insurance, 401K match, gym facilities, PTO, growth potential, and an exciting and challenging work environment.
HRL Laboratories is an Equal Employment Opportunity employer and does not discriminate in recruiting, hiring, training or promoting, on the basis of race, ethnicity, color, creed, religion, sex, sexual orientation, gender, gender identity, genetic information, national origin, physical or mental disability, pregnancy, medical condition, age, U.
S.
military or protected veteran status, union membership, or political affiliation.
We maintain a drug-free workplace and perform pre-employment substance abuse testing.
For our privacy policy please visit :
This position must meet Export Control compliance requirements, therefore a U.
S.
Person as defined by 22 C.
F.
R.
120.
15is required.
U.
S.
Person includes U.
S.
Citizen, lawful permanent resident, refugee, or asylee.
.
Estimated Salary: $20 to $28 per hour based on qualifications.

Don't Be a Victim of Fraud

  • Electronic Scams
  • Home-based jobs
  • Fake Rentals
  • Bad Buyers
  • Non-Existent Merchandise
  • Secondhand Items
  • More...

Don't Be Fooled

The fraudster will send a check to the victim who has accepted a job. The check can be for multiple reasons such as signing bonus, supplies, etc. The victim will be instructed to deposit the check and use the money for any of these reasons and then instructed to send the remaining funds to the fraudster. The check will bounce and the victim is left responsible.